Darlington residents have been encouraged to book a free electric blanket safety test.

Every year, a third of electric blankets in use by Darlington residents are found to be unsafe. Since 2003, there have been 1725 blankets tested and 651 were found to be unfit for use.

Between Monday 16 and Tuesday 17 September, residents are invited to attend a free electric blanket safety test at Age UK North Yorkshire and Darlington, Bradbury House. You can book an appointment by phone on 01325 357345, and booking is required.

These safety checks, which have been organised by Darlington Borough Council’s trading standards team, Age UK North Yorkshire and Darlington, and County Durham and Darlington Fire and Rescue Service, will be conducted by a qualified engineer.

How to use an electric blanket safely:

Do:

  • read and follow the manufacturer’s instructions before use
  • examine your blanket regularly for signs of wear and tear
  • use the blanket only for the purpose the manufacturer intended for example,
    • over-blankets must only be positioned above the occupant of the bed
    • under-blankets must only be positioned under the occupant of the bed
  • check the manufacturer’s instructions for suitability to wash your blanket
  • carry out a visual check of the blanket to make sure the blanket is intact with no visible signs of damage caused in transport when first purchased

Don’t

  • use blanket whilst it is still folded, rucked, or creased
  • use a hot water bottle at the same time as using your electric blanket
  • touch the blanket with wet hands or feet
  • insert or use pins to hold the blanket in place on the bed
  • use under-blankets on adjustable beds, or if used on an adjustable bed, check that the blanket and the cord do not become trapped
  • use an electric blanket on the bed of a helpless person, an infant, or a person with a condition that makes them insensitive to heat
  • allowing the appliance to be used by young children unless the controls have been pre-set by a parent/carer or that you are satisfied that the child is able to use the appliance safely
  • Allow people with pacemakers fitted to use heated bedding for all night use
